Koules Fortress

Koules Fortress, also known as the Rocca al Mare, is a coastal stronghold located at the entrance of the old harbor in Heraklion, Crete, Greece. Built by the Venetians in the early 16th century, it serves as a key defensive fortification controlling access to the city's port. Today, it stands as one of Heraklion's most recognizable landmarks and a major historical attraction. (Photo by Nikolas Kokovlis/NurPhoto)
